About 5-ethyl-N-propylnonan-1-amine

5-ethyl-N-propylnonan-1-amine (PubChem CID 64504205) has the molecular formula C14H31N and a molecular weight of 213.41 g/mol. Its IUPAC name is 5-ethyl-N-propylnonan-1-amine.
